Lambda sensors info is only used in idle and cruise (PART THROTTLE) situations on something as old as that. Known as 'closed loop' operation where the feedback from the various sensors is used and the PCM tries to keep the AFR at Lambda 1 (14.7:1 AFR)
On full throttle the fuel system is in 'open loop' and AFRs will be lower (richer) for full power/torque and component protection.
If your car passes the MOT emission test and has no error codes relative to Lambda sensor, it should be working fine.
